Could a discarded napkin hold the key to solving a decades-old murder? On this episode we uncover the chilling story of Jeannie Childs, a vibrant 35-year-old whose life was violently taken in her Minneapolis apartment. With the advent of genetic genealogy, a breakthrough finally emerged, leading investigators to Jerry Westrom, whose DNA led to his arrest and conviction.
This is a tribute not only to Jeannie and her loved ones but also to the power of determination and the advances in forensic technology that brought closure to a haunting mystery.
